Dual Dust Removal System - keeps the CCD clean Every time a DSLR camera’s lens is changed, the CCD is exposed to dust.
If dust settles on the CCD, it can manifest itself as a glaring flaw in
pictures. In order to prevent this from happening, the GX-10’s CCD
features a special anti-dust coating that keeps pictures free of
unsightly blemishes. In addition to the CCD’s anti-dust coating, the GX-10 features an
advanced dust removal function in which the CCD is lightly shaken at
startup in order to shed any pesky dust that may have withstood the
resistant coating. In addition to reducing the need for post-purchase
professional cleaning, this function ensures clear, flawless pictures. The Dust Removal function can be set to either manual or automatic from the menu.
The GX-10 takes fantastic pictures everywhere and at all times, even when the rain falls or the dust blows GX-10’s body is specially crafted to resist the influx of water or dust. A
secure silicone seal has been implemented at 72 different points,
including the shutter and other important buttons, to ensure that
nothing harmful enters the camera. Due to the GX-10’s tough build, it can be used in both good
environments and bad. Whether it’s rainy, dusty, or sandy, you can
shoot with confidence and peace of mind.
Featuring the Glass Pentaprism In an SLR camera, images that enter the lens are reflected to the
viewfinder. The vividness and visibility ratio of what is seen are
determined according to the use of the reflective device. In
conjunction with the Glass Pentaprism, the GX-10’s broad and clear
viewfinder offers a fantastic 95% field of view with 0.95X
magnification, ensuring a bright and clear view.

A new dimension of resolution While
common DSLR products utilize 16bit A/D conversion, GX-10 adopts a 22
bit A/D converter, which can process 1,024 times more image information
at a time than other DSLR cameras. As such, it can express delicate
colors, textures, sharpness, and a wide range of gradation. GX-10 utilizes a cutting-edge semiconductor processor
and Samsung high-speed DDR2 memory to realize fast, high-quality
imaging. The DSP enables more natural definition, a wide range of
gradation, continuous shooting, and a prompt response to dynamic
subjects. GX-10 adopts a brand-new user-friendly exposure mode to control shutter speed, aperture, and even ISO sensitivity. Sv: Sensitivity priority Automatically adjusts aperture and shutter speed settings according to ISO levels TAv:
Shutter-speed & aperture priority Automatically controls ISO
sensitivity to get an appropriate exposure value according to the
user’s shutter speed and aperture settings. While existing white-balancing functions use
only standard values according to the situation, GX-10 provides a
delicate color temperature adjustment function by 100K units, which
enables more accurate white-balance control.
Capturing a moment in time Through cutting-edge digital technology, the GX-10 offers numerous ways
to capture dynamic moments that pass in the blink of an eye. Effectively photographing a continuously moving subject is not an easy
matter for common users. GX-10 provides a high-speed motor drive
shooting function (3 frames/sec) based on the innovative AF speed,
which enables you to capture any movement of a subject perfectly. In
the JPEG shooting mode, continuous shooting is limitless within the
memory capacity, and the RAW mode enables taking 9 photos per second,
in contrast to other continuous shooting cameras, which generally take
only 3 per second. GX-10 adopts 11 focus points for prompt, precise AF use in response to
subjects at both short and long distances. Specifically, 9 central
focus points are used to adjust the focus accurately from any direction
with the Cross-Sensor, vertically and horizontally. With the 9 central
and left/right focus points, GX-10 provides flexibility in angle
decision so as to take the focus of subjects out of the center. Also
provided is the focus point converting function, by which a user can
choose the location of the AF subject, and the super-impose function
for red lighting at the focus point. DSLR focus point conversion is a frequently used
function. For prompt AF use in response to a subject, the focus point
converting function makes use of the dial button on the back so as to
find and use the function on the menu while shooting. You can choose
Auto, User''s Option (adjusting the location of a focus point with the
direction button), or Central from the menu.
